Key Takeaways
- In 2023, Google processed an average of 8.5 billion searches per day worldwide, representing over 99% of all internet searches
- Users perform approximately 16,420 searches per second on Google globally as of 2024
- Monthly Google searches worldwide reached 99 billion in Q1 2024, up 5% year-over-year
- Bing holds 3.58% global desktop search market share in March 2024
- Google commands 91.47% of global search engine market share across all devices in April 2024
- In the US, Google's search share is 88.66% as of Q1 2024, followed by Amazon at 1.82%
- "YouTube" was the most searched term globally with 105 million searches in April 2024
- "Weather" ranked second with 83 million global searches on Google in April 2024
- "Amazon" saw 53 million searches worldwide in April 2024, reflecting e-commerce dominance
- Mobile searches account for 63% of all Google queries in 2024, up from 50% in 2016
- Desktop searches comprise 36% of global volume but generate 52% of clicks in 2024
- Tablet search share stabilized at 1.2% globally in 2024
- Global search advertising generated $224 billion in revenue for Google in 2023
- SEM industry worldwide valued at $282 billion in 2024 projections
- Cost-per-click (CPC) average for Google Ads rose to $2.69 in 2024
Google overwhelmingly dominates global search, processing trillions of queries annually for billions of users.
